This commit reimplements the C# API in terms of a Wasmtime linker. It removes the custom binding implementation that was based on reflection in favor of the linker's implementation. This should make the C# API a little closer to the Rust API. The `Engine` and `Store` types have been hidden behind the `Host` type which is responsible for hosting WebAssembly module instances. Documentation and tests have been updated.
